I had DirecTV for two years before switching to Uverse. My experience with DirecTV was full of amazingly slow menus and channel changes, frequent audio drops, and occasional weather disturbances. I can tell that I took a slight step downward in picture quality, but I also do not have any of the issues mentioned.

What's my point? DirecTV is running some crazy deals right now and I would be interested in switching back IF those issues are gone.

So, my question is, are the menus still slow? Is it still 3-4 seconds between channel changes? What about audio drops?

I believe I had an H21 receiver before - anything newer and better out now that improves or corrects those issues? Was I the only person that had those issues with DirecTV?

I have an HR20 and an HR23. The HR23 is slower than the HR20, but I don't see channel changes as being as slow as you described. Maybe 2 seconds tops. There are no audio dropouts as before. The weather outages can be ameliorated by a good dish alignment.
